首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在vscode中让Javascript自动完成字符串参数?

在VSCode中,可以通过安装并配置相应的插件来实现让JavaScript自动完成字符串参数的功能。以下是一个推荐的插件和配置方法:

  1. 打开VSCode,点击左侧的扩展按钮(四个方块图标),在搜索栏中输入 "JavaScript"。
  2. 在搜索结果中找到并点击 "JavaScript (ES6) code snippets" 插件,然后点击安装按钮进行安装。
  3. 安装完成后,点击扩展栏中的齿轮图标,选择 "扩展设置"。
  4. 在设置页面中,在搜索栏中输入 "snippets"。
  5. 在搜索结果中找到并点击 "Edit in settings.json",这将打开一个 JSON 文件用于编辑设置。
  6. 在打开的 JSON 文件中,添加以下配置:
代码语言:txt
复制
"javascript.preferences.useCodeSnippetsOnMethodSuggest": true
  1. 保存并关闭文件。

现在,在编写JavaScript代码时,当输入字符串参数时,VSCode将自动显示相关的代码片段建议,包括字符串处理、正则表达式等常见的代码块。只需按下 Tab 键或回车键,即可选择和插入所需的代码片段。

此外,腾讯云还提供了一系列与JavaScript开发相关的云服务产品,如云函数SCF(Serverless Cloud Function)和云开发COS(Cloud Object Storage)。您可以通过以下链接了解更多详情:

  1. 云函数 SCF:云函数SCF是无服务器架构的事件驱动计算服务,支持JavaScript等多种编程语言,能够帮助开发者构建弹性、可扩展的云端应用。
  2. 云开发 COS:云开发COS是腾讯云提供的对象存储服务,可用于存储和管理大规模的静态文件,支持JavaScript SDK进行快速开发。

通过以上方法配置VSCode,您将能够在JavaScript开发中更加高效地完成字符串参数的自动补全。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

TypeScript是如何工作的

TypeScript 是一门基于 JavaScript 拓展的语言,它是 JavaScript 的超集,并且给 JavaScript 添加了静态类型检查系统。...二、TypeScript 与 VSCode 当我们在 VSCode 中新建一个 TypeScript 文件并输入 TS 代码时,可以发现 VSCode 自动对代码做了高亮,甚至在类型不一致的地方,VSCode...Babel 有两种常见使用场景,一种是直接在 CLI 调用 babel 命令,另一种是将Babel 和打包工具( webpack)结合使用。...由于 babel 自身并不具备打包功能,所以直接在命令行调用 babel 命令的用处不大,本节主要讨论如何在 webpack 中使用 babel 处理 typescript。...生成:把转换后的 AST 转换成字符串形式的代码,同时创建源码映射。对应 babel-generator。

5.4K30

写给前端同学的终端修炼手册

我们可以参考此篇文章 - 如何在 Windows 10 上安装和使用 Zsh[4] 一旦设置完成,我们就可以配置终端应用程序使用 Bash 或 Zsh。...echo 命令非常类似于JavaScript的 console.log 函数。 和函数一样,命令接受参数。在这种情况下,echo 接受一个参数,即要输出的字符串。...例如:DATE=(date)echo "Today's date is 参数扩展和子字符串操作: 符号用于参数扩展,允许你对变量进行子字符串操作、默认值替换等。...和前端相关的终端操作 到目前为止,我们已经看到了一些如何在终端完成任务的示例。接下来,我们来看看和前端相关的终端操作。 管理依赖 假设这是我们在新公司的第一天。...一旦完成,第二个命令会自动运行。 一旦我掌握了链接的技巧,我们就开始到处使用它。

11710

Vscode笔记-24款插件

Auto Close Tag 前端神器,只需要编写左标签,例如,,等,会自动替我们完成右侧标签的填充:, , 等。...只需注意左侧的灯泡,然后按一下它即可了解如何在光标下转换代码。 json2ts 可将JSON转换为TypeScript接口。您可以从VS Code浏览和安装扩展。...Node.js Modules Intellisense Visual Studio Code插件,可以自动完成导入语句中的JavaScript / TypeScript模块。...TypeScript Importer 在工作空间文件自动搜索TypeScript定义,并提供所有已知符号作为完成项以允许代码完成。...Browser Preview,在vscode实现预览调试 Settings Sync 上传和拉取 vscode 可以快速完成配置,自动安装相关扩展 搜索扩展并安装Settings Sync 拉取公共配置文件和扩展

10.5K21

visual studio code使用教程_visual studio code 权威指南 pdf

对于后者,本文将为你介绍如何在 VSCode 上设置 snippets,并为你提供一套可以直接用的 C 语言 snippets。 1....代码片的「布局与控制」; 注:每个字符串表示一行。 description:描述。代码片在 IntelliSense 的「介绍」。 注:可选。...", "scope": "javascript,typescript" } 3.3 Scope 部分 前缀部分没有什么好介绍的,不过在引入了域的概念之后,会不由自主地想起一些问题,比如如何同一条代码片根据语言进行微调...当变量未赋值时(),将插入其缺省值或空字符串。 当varibale未知(即,其名称未定义)时,将插入变量的名称,并将其转换为「Placeholder」。...参数项的说明2。

10.9K61

实例解析:如何开发 VSCode LSP 服务

这是一个基本模板,主要完成了 Language Server 各种初始化操作,后续就可以使用 connection.onXXX 或 documents.onXXX 监听各类交互事件,并在事件回调返回符合...悬停提示 当鼠标停留在语言元素函数、变量、符号等 token 时,VSCode 会显示 token 对应描述与帮助信息: ?...代码格式化 代码格式化是一个特别有用的功能,能够帮助用户快速、自动完成代码的美化处理,实现效果如: ?...回调函数主要实现将连续大写字符串格式化为驼峰字符串,效果如图: ?...总结一下,LSP 架构的工作流程如下: 编辑器 VSCode 跟踪、计算、管理用户行为模型,在发生某些特定的行为序列时,以 LSP 协议规定的通讯方式向 Language Server 发送动作与上下文参数

1.4K50

实例解析:如何开发 VSCode LSP 服务

这是一个基本模板,主要完成了 Language Server 各种初始化操作,后续就可以使用 connection.onXXX 或 documents.onXXX 监听各类交互事件,并在事件回调返回符合...代码格式化 代码格式化是一个特别有用的功能,能够帮助用户快速、自动完成代码的美化处理,实现效果如: 实现悬停提示功能,首先需要声明插件支持 documentFormattingProvider 特性:...回调函数主要实现将连续大写字符串格式化为驼峰字符串,效果如图: 函数签名 函数签名特性在用户输入函数调用语法时触发,此时 VSCode 会根据 Language Server 返回的内容,显示该函数的帮助信息...这两个网页提供了 VSCode 所支持的所有语言特性的详细介绍,可以在这里找到你想要实现的特性的概念性描述,例如对于代码补齐: 嗯,有点复杂且太过 detail,不过还是很有必要耐心了解下,你对即将要做的事情有一个高层概念上的理解...总结一下,LSP 架构的工作流程如下: 编辑器 VSCode 跟踪、计算、管理用户行为模型,在发生某些特定的行为序列时,以 LSP 协议规定的通讯方式向 Language Server 发送动作与上下文参数

2.7K20

还在用收费的GitHub Copilot AI助手吗?out了,国产的CodeGeeX完全可以替代,而且完全免费!

回答任何问题:CodeGeeX的功能要比GitHub Copilot强大,相当于GPT模型,不仅可以回答编程问题,还可以回答任何问题,“你觉得人类未来的命运会如何,是走向繁荣,还是走向衰落,甚至灭亡!...安装CodeGeeX CodeGeeX支持VSCode和JetBrains IDEs,本节主要介绍如何在VSCode安装CodeGeeX,在JetBrains IDEs安装的详细步骤可以参考下面的官方文档...: http://codegeex.ai/zh-CN/downloadGuide#idea 在VSCode上安装CodeGeeX,只需要在VSCode的扩展搜索CodeGeeX,就可以找到如下图所示的...代码优化 在Ask CodeGeeX页面输入如下内容优化代码: 下面是用Python编写的冒泡排序算法,请优化一下这段代码,其效率更高。...Code文本框,CodeGeeX会自动识别Input Code文本框的代码是什么语言。

1.5K10

悟空活动台-打造 Nodejs 版本的MyBatis

希望借此来充分发挥JavaScript 的效能,可以更高效、更高质量的完成产品的迭代。...避免 SQL 的字符串拼接。 防止 SQL 注入。 自动对动态参数进行 SQL 防注入。 声明式事务机制。 借助 decorator 更容易进行事务声明。...思路是将其转换为 JavaScript 表达式字符串,目标就是转化为下述字符串。...图-6 tts 类型文件的使用 (2)LSP VSCode 基本成为前端开发编辑器的第一选择,另外通过 VSCode 架构的 LSP(语言服务协议)可以完成很多 IDE 的功能,为我们的开发提供更智能的帮助...比如我们在使用 Node-MyBatis 需要编写大量的 SQL 字符串,对于 VSCode 来说,这就是一个普通的 JavaScript字符串,没有任何特殊之处。

5.5K20

vivo悟空活动台-打造 Nodejs 版本的MyBatis

希望借此来充分发挥JavaScript 的效能,可以更高效、更高质量的完成产品的迭代。...避免 SQL 的字符串拼接。 防止 SQL 注入。自动对动态参数进行 SQL 防注入。 声明式事务机制。借助 decorator 更容易进行事务声明。 结合 Typescript 的类型。...思路是将其转换为 JavaScript 表达式字符串,目标就是转化为下述字符串。...(2)LSP VSCode 基本成为前端开发编辑器的第一选择,另外通过 VSCode 架构的 LSP(语言服务协议)可以完成很多 IDE 的功能,为我们的开发提供更智能的帮助。...比如我们在使用 Node-MyBatis 需要编写大量的 SQL 字符串,对于 VSCode 来说,这就是一个普通的 JavaScript字符串,没有任何特殊之处。

1.3K40

VSCode插件大全|VSCode高级玩家之第二篇

这种写法想使用“某道翻译”在编辑器悬浮翻译就是不可能了。 找了很久我为大家找到一个非常好用的一个插件可以解决这个问题! 本地77万词条英汉词典,不依赖任何在线翻译API,无查询次数限制。...小技巧 我们可以通过在settings.json强制一些特定语言用这个格式化工具。在settings.json添加以下配置。...提供了一种安全的方法在VSCode呈现web内容,并支持一些有趣的特性,编辑器内调试等! 再也不用在浏览器和编辑器来回切换而觉得麻烦了!...它的功能包含以下: 快速驼峰/下划线大小写代码完成(智能感知)。提供文档、项目和内置符号和关键字的详细提示。自动添加使用声明。 项目和内置的构造函数,方法和函数都有详细签名(参数)帮助辅助。...Java 语言支持(Red Hat 提供) 代码导航 自动完成 重构 代码片段 ? Java 调试器 ? Java测试运行器 项目脚手架 自定义目标 ?

4.6K30

提高 JavaScript 开发效率的高级VSCode扩展!

原文:提高 JavaScript 开发效率的高级 VSCode 扩展!...Quokka.js类似的扩展 – Code Runner – 支持多种语言,C,C ++,Java,JavaScript,PHP,Python,Perl,Perl 6等。...这些扩展将为你的编辑器添加一系列颜色,并使代码块易于辨别,一旦你习惯了它们,如果 VSCode 没有它们就会人觉得很平淡。...但是,既然编辑器可以轻松地完成相同的任务,为什么还要使用不同的应用程序呢? REST Client 它允许你发送 HTTP 请求并直接在 Visual Studio 代码查看响应。 ?...当你更改相同的标签时,关闭标记会自动更改,这两个扩展就是这样做的。 它还适用于JSX和许多其他语言,XML,PHP,Vue,JavaScript,TypeScript,TSX。

2.5K50

四两拨千斤——你不知道的VScode编码TypeScript的技巧

,可以添加VScode标记,使用TAB移动 l 描述,此项为可选内容,如果不使用则在IntelliSense下拉菜单列出的项目出现时显示其名称 上面的示例我们创建了一个自定义代码段,当开始编写“...-- l BLOCK_COMMENT_END输出示例:JavaScript*/或HTML--> l LINE_COMMENT 示例输出:在JavaScript // 举一些例子加以说明: ?...可选择的范围包括:在打开和关闭字符串括号后添加空格,在函数的新行添加括号,处理分号(可选择忽略,添加缺失的括号或自动将其全部删除)。...通过此列表,我们可以自定义VSCode,使代码风格更符合个人编码习惯。完成后,通过选择命令面板上的“设置文档格式”选项生效。...3.简化功能签名 将过多参数通过将对象分解添加到混合中进行简化: ? 选择所有参数,然后单击灯泡,选择“将参数转换为变形的对象” ?

3.8K30

插件 转

VSCode 拓展插件推荐 插件列表 Auto Close Tag 自动闭合HTML标签 Auto Rename Tag 修改HTML标签时,自动修改匹配的标签 Bookmarks 添加行书签 Can...颜色值在代码中高亮显示 Color Picker 拾色器 Document This 注释文档生成 EditorConfig for VS Code EditorConfig 插件 Emoji 在代码输入...emoji ESLint ESLint插件,高亮提示 File Peek 根据路径字符串,快速定位到文件 Font-awesome codes for html FontAwesome提示代码段 ftp-sync...Path Intellisense 另一个路径完成提示 Prettify JSON 格式化JSON Project Manager 快速切换项目 REST Client 发送REST风格的HTTP请求...Settings Sync VSCode设置同步到Gist String Manipulation 字符串转换处理(驼峰、大写开头、下划线等等) Test Spec Generator 测试用例生成(

79230
领券